Electricity Prices in Thompson, IA
Residential Electricity Rates in Thompson
Residential electricity prices in Thompson, IA in May 2025 averaged approximately 14.23 cents per kilowatthour (¢/kWh), which was about 19% less than the national average rate of 17.47 ¢/kWh (May 2025). [1]

Natural Gas Prices in Thompson, IA
Residential Natural Gas Rates in Thompson
Residential natural gas prices in Thompson in May 2025 averaged 16.37 dollars per thousand cubic feet ($/Mcf), which was approximately 15% less than the national average rate of 19.18 $/Mcf (May 2025). [2]

Solar Power in Thompson, IA
Solar Radiation Levels in Thompson
The city of Thompson (Iowa) has an average annual solar radiation value of 4.85 kilowatt hours per square meter per day (kWh/m2/day). Compare Thompson values to both low and high values in the U.S. overall: [3]
Average monthly solar radition in Thompson is 27% lower than an example high average monthly solar radiation in NV.
Average monthly solar radition in Thompson is 23% higher than an example low average monthly solar radiation in WA.
